Description
[By Jodocus Hondius (Joost de Hondt)][In Purchas His Pilgrimes in Five Bookes, Book 4, 437861][Printed by William Stansby for Henrie Fetherstone, London, 1625]14.5 cm x 18.5 cm Watermarked paper. Modern color. Right edge of page appears to have been trimmed in binding, slightly cutting into the map’s lower right margin, so a strip of paper has been added. Book page headed “Chap. 18. Asia. The fourth Booke. 437.” Oriented with west at the top. It displays China as far west as Burma in Southeast Asia. Korea is shown as an island. The northern end of Luzon in the Philippines and southwestern end of Japan appear as well. The text, in English, describes animals raised for food and comments extensively on travel via inland waterways, including from Macao to Peking. The reverse is a page of text describing, among other things, the ornate ships that Mandarin magistrates travel on, the local wildlife, the use of porcelain vessels, trade in silver traded by weight, types of textiles and wood, and “a kind of Reed (the Portugals call it Bambu) almost as hard as iron.”
